Was Denmark's most popular car – now sales are plummeting

The Tesla Model Y was Denmark's most popular car all of last year. But the latest figures reveal that sales are plummeting.

Sales of the new Tesla Model Y have more than halved in Denmark.

In fact, it's down a whopping 52 percent this year when compared to the same period last year, when Tesla sold 4,701 new Model Ys in the first three months.

It has now shrunk to 2,258 copies of the same car model. However, Tesla is still sitting on a solid part of Danish new car sales. Namely 9.5 percent.

This is shown by the latest report from De Danske Bilimportorer.

However, there is a long way to go to first place, which Toyota, with just under 5,000 new cars on Danish roads, has narrowly missed.

If you look up the sales figures for individual car models, it is somewhat surprising that a whole third brand pulled the load. At least in the month of April.

Here, Renault managed to sell 671 copies of the Megane E-Tech, which may, however, be connected to a number of discounts from the importer. Also on lease.

If you look at Toyota's sales in the month of April, it looks a bit more sluggish. The best-selling model is the Yaris Cross with 211 cars. Neither enough for a top 3 or, for that matter, top 5.

The little Japanese is messing around in 15th place. But overall, for this year, things are going best for Toyota.
